Having problem with data.load.elf commands

Hi,

I tried to use cmm-style command to do load ELF file to my platform.

The script I used in my .cmm file:

    data.load.elf "fpga_a64.elf"

However I got below error code after I source the .cmm file:

- - -

ERROR(CMM10-IMG88):
! Failed to load image "fpga_a64.elf"
! Unsupported ELF File (EI_CLASS=ELFCLASS64, e_machine=EM_AARCH64)
ERROR(CMD656): The script C:\{path}\trial.cmm failed to complete due to an error during execution of the script

- - -

What should I do to deal with this problem?

Thanks.

  • That error message will be reported if you try to load an AArch64 ELF image for an AArch32 processor.

    This can happen on boards that contain both Armv8-A (Cortex-Axx) and Cortex-M processors, and you accidentally connect the debugger to the wrong one.
